  I have a 3rd gen Intel laptop with only Ubuntu 19.10 installed, and a monitor 
attached via DisplayPort. The monitor has a native resolution of 2560x1080. 
When I power on my laptop, it is seemingly random whether one of the three 
following situations occurs. 
  1. Displays at the proper native resolution of 2560x1080,
  2. Displays at 1600x1200 but not let me select a higher resolution in display 
settings, or 
  3. The display will fail to connect and stay blank (when I enter display 
settings it will be on "Single Monitor" mode, but from there I can enable Join 
Displays and set it to its native resolution).

  Please note I selected "I don't know" instead of gdm3 or lightdm since
  i've been having this issue since before installing/switching to
  lightdm.
